TuneIn failure
TuneIn is a popular online radio service that was down for a short time this week. Not only did the apps for the individual platforms no longer work as usual, but also Internet radios that access the service only reported that an error had occurred. After just under an hour, all channels were back to normal.

Spotify bans the Android widget
Almost no user of the Spotify Android app liked this news. The streaming provider removed the long-standing widget for the home screen this week. This means that it can no longer be placed from now on. If it is already on the start screen, it will no longer work. Spotify has already commented on this step and said that the widget was unnecessary because there are playback controls for Android in the notification center.
Contact lens with zoom function
Our new editor Andi discovered a pretty exciting gadget on the Internet that could come from films like "Back to the Future": a contact lens with a zoom function. The University of California San Diego worked on this. Double blinking triggers a mechanism that triggers the zoom effect. You can read exactly how this works in the article.
